Course Description

DuPage Golf operates three public golf courses near Chicago, offering a mix of country club heritage and modern amenities across The Preserve at Oak Meadows, Maple Meadows, and Green Meadows. The organization provides 18-hole championship and 9-hole courses, practice facilities, and dining options, with event planning and clubhouses to serve residents and visitors in Addison, IL. It emphasizes accessible tee times, golf instruction, and related hospitality services through its on-site restaurants and mobile app for booking. The facilities are part of the Forest Preserve District of DuPage County and focus on providing a comprehensive public golf experience in the Chicago area.

How difficult is The Preserve for mid-handicap golfers?

The Preserve is regarded as a strategically complex layout. The 120 slope rating keeps it accessible for developing players. The course rating of 70 reflects on scoring relative to par 71.

What tees should a 15 handicap play at The Preserve?

A 15 handicap golfer should consider tees closer to 6000 yards. The back tees extend to 6500 yards, which makes approach shots longer and scoring more challenging.

What is considered a good score at The Preserve?

With a course rating of 70 and par 71, a mid-handicap golfer would typically score in the mid to high 80s. Stronger players aiming to break 71 must manage approach shots and avoid penalty strokes.

How long is The Preserve and how does yardage affect play?

At a full length of 6500 yards, it balances distance with positional strategy.

What type of course is The Preserve and how should I play it?

Architecturally, it reflects a Parkland style. Overall, the setup will reward players who place the ball in safe positions far from hazards. Also, type of shot is more crucial rather than just trying to gain distance.

What features make The Preserve strategically challenging?

The combination of a slope rating of 120 and yardage reaching 6500 yards creates consistent pressure on approach shots. You will need to balance risk and reward, especially on longer par 4s and protected greens.
